Struct Emission 

Source
pub struct Emission { /* private fields */ }
Expand description

What one call to a stage produced: the bytes it emitted, how they are framed, and what it asked the host to do about its own schedule.

One struct rather than four borrows because they are written together and read together, and because a stage’s whole answer is exactly these four things. The host keeps one per buffer and resets it between calls, so a steady stream allocates nothing here after the first few chunks.

impl Emission

Source

pub fn new() -> Self

Source

pub fn reset(&mut self)

Ready for a fresh call, keeping the allocations.

Source

pub fn bytes(&self) -> &[u8]

Everything the stage emitted, concatenated.

Source

pub fn bounds(&self) -> &[usize]

The framing of bytes. Empty means one unit.

Source

pub fn emit(&self) -> Emit

What the stage did with what it was given.

Source

pub fn rearm_requested(&self) -> bool

Whether the stage asked for its schedule to be restarted. See Ctx::rearm.
